FY2016-10 Amending the 2008 Comprehensive Plan by changing land use designation of Lot 1 sawmill subdivision from open space to industrial/light industrial Introduced by: Borough Manager Requested by: P&Z Commission I Drafted by: CDD Staff 2 Introduced: 12/17/2015 3 Public Hearing: 01/07/2016 4 Adopted: 01/07/2016 5 6 KODIAK ISLAND BOROUGH 7 ORDINANCE NO. FY2016-10 8 9 AN ORDINANCE OF THE ASSEMBLY OF THE KODIAK ISLAND 10 BOROUGH AMENDING THE 2008 COMPREHENSIVE PLAN BY 11 CHANGING THE FUTURE LAND USE DESIGNATION OF LOT 1, 12 SAWMILL SUBDIVISION FROM OPEN SPACE/RECREATION TO 13 INDUSTRIAULIGHT INDUSTRIAL (P&Z CASE NO. 16-003) 14 15 WHEREAS, as a second class Borough, the Kodiak Island Borough excercises 16 planning, platting, and land use regulations on an area wide basis pursuant to Chapter 17 29.40 Alaska Statutes; and 18 19 WHEREAS, in accordance with AS 29.40, the Kodiak Island Borough adopted the 2008 20 Comprehensive Plan update on December 6, 2007 (Ordinance No. FY2008-10) to replace 21 the 1968 Comprehensive Plan; and 22 23 WHEREAS, the Kodiak Island Borough has adopted KIBC Title 17 (Zoning) in 24 accordance with AS 29.40 to implement the Kodiak Island Borough Comprehensive Plan; 25 and 26 27 WHEREAS, KIBC 17.205.010 provides that "Whenever the public necessity, 28 convenience, general welfare or good zoning practice requires, the assembly may, by 29 ordinance and after report thereon by the commission and public hearing as required by 30 law, amend, supplement, modify, repeal or otherwise change these regulations and the 31 boundaries of the districts;" and 32 33 WHEREAS, the Planning and Zoning Commission received a request to amend the 34 2008 Comprehensive Plan by changing the Future Land Use Designation of Lot 1, Sawmill 35 Subdivision; and 36 37 WHEREAS, at an advertised public hearing, consistent with Kodiak Island Borough 38 Code 17.205.040, the Commission considered the merits of the Comprehensive Plan 39 amendment request; and 40 41 WHEREAS, the Commission voted to recommend to the Borough Assembly that the 42 Comprehensive Plan Future Land Use Designation of this lot be changed finding that the 43 public necessity, convenience, general welfare, and good zoning practice would be 44 enhanced by such action; and 45 46 WHEREAS, the Commission hereby recommends that this 'amendment request be 47 reviewed and approved by the Borough Assembly. 48 49 Kodiak Island Borough„Alaska Ordinance No. FY2016-10 Page 1 of 2 50 N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T ORDAINED BY THE ASSEMBLY OF THE KODIAK ISLAND 51 BOROUGH that: 52 53 Section 1: This ordinance is not of a general and permanent nature and shall not 54 become a part of the Kodiak Island Borough Code of Ordinances; and 55 56 Section 2: The 2008 Comprehensive Plan Future Land Use Designation of Lot 1, 57 Sawmill Subdivision is hereby changed from Open Space/Recreation to 58 Industrial/Light Industrial. 59 60 Section 3: The findings of the Kodiak Island Borough Planning and Zoning 61 Commission are confirmed as follows:' 62 63 1. The amendment will recognize long standing industrial uses on this site. 64 65 2. The lot is of sufficient area and provides suitable building sites for industrial use. 66 67 3. The lot is adjacent to I-Industrial zoned land and uses. 68 69 4. Adequate buffers between this lot and nearby residential development are 70 established by ordinance and plat restrictions. 71 72 5. The lot appears to be capable of accommodating the full range of industrial uses 73 without negatively impacting the surrounding area. The I-Industrial zoning 74 performance standards (KIBC 17.105.060) should further ensure that there are no 75 negative impacts with future industrial development. 76 77 6. The amendment is consistent with various objectives of the adopted 2008 78 Comprehensive Plan and will facilitate a rezone that will further implement those 79 objectives. 80 81 7.
